- The distance between Nakhon Si Thammarat, Thailand and KIROVOBAD (GANDZHA), Azerbaijan is approximately 6,354 km or 3,949 mi.
- To reach Nakhon Si Thammarat in this distance one would set out from KIROVOBAD (GANDZHA) bearing 108.8°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Nakhon Si Thammarat bearing 133.5° or SE .
- Nakhon Si Thammarat has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am) whereas KIROVOBAD (GANDZHA) has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k).
- Nakhon Si Thammarat is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as KIROVOBAD (GANDZHA) is in or near the warm temperate thorn steppe bi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 14 °C (25.2°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 21.3 °C (38.3°F) less in Nakhon Si Thammarat.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 2083 mm (82 in) more which is equivalent to 2083 l/m² (51.12 US gal/ft²) or 20,830,000 l/ha (2,226,865 US gal/ac) more. About 8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 24.6° higher in Nakhon Si Thammarat than in KIROVOBAD (GANDZHA).
